Runbook: BounceHound account recovery. If the bounce processor's service account locks out, do not reset via the admin panel — that orphans the queue consumer. Instead, restore from the sealed recovery profile in the Fennelmark vault. New folks: the vault prompt expects the team recovery passphrase, not your personal login. After unlock, restart the consumer and confirm bounce classification resumes. The current recovery passphrase appears on the line below.

strongbox words: praath-queniel-holax-druael-jorath-noveth-druok

The retention sweeper (service name: Gleanrake) runs nightly and purges records past their configured retention window. Before changing any policy file, confirm the legal hold list in the Harrowfield console, since Gleanrake skips held records only if the hold flag is synced. Dry-run mode is mandatory for first-time operators. Questions about edge cases should go to the data stewardship inbox.

escalation mailbox, bafog-fafog: ulador@paliqlabs.internal

**Ticket: Config drift on Ledgerpine export workers**

The spreadsheet export pods in staging are running with double the heap cap of production, which is masking the memory regression we discussed last sync. Marit confirmed drift began after the Thornbury rollout. Before we tune anything, we should baseline against the intended values, reproduced below.

service settings:
PRAWYN_PIN=9848
PRAWYN_METRICS_HOST=metrics.prawyn.lumicworks.corp
PRAWYN_LOG_LEVEL=warn
PRAWYN_TENANT=pelius